Abstract
478,453. Changespeed gearing. NICOL, T. S. Nov. 24, 1936, No. 32111. [Class 80 (ii)] Change - speed gearing suitable for vehicles comprises a toothed pinion 20 slidable on a driven shaft 19 by a mechanical relay set in motion by a manual lever 48, Fig. 1. For forward speeds, the pinion 20 is meshed alternatively with gears 17, 18 of equal size loose on a shaft 15 and driven at different speeds from a driving-shaft 11 which carries a gear 14 meshed directly by the pinion 20 for reversed drive. Between the pinion 20 and a transverse arm 22 which operates it, is a double-acting spring barrel 21, Fig. 2, with two springs 34, 36 and stops arranged so that the stroke of the arm 22 can be completed in both directions, and the pinion 20 follows into mesh when it can. The relay striking movement is effected by pivoting the arm 22 about the shaft 19 so as to bring two half-nuts 24 carried by the arm into engagement alternatively with screws 25, 26 constantly driven in opposite directions from the engine shaft 11. To effect a gear change, a quadrilateral slide 45 is slid axially by the hand lever 48. By oblique guides 44, a shuttle 37 is thus displaced transversely carrying with it the striker arm 22. A tongue 38 on the arm which slides in a longitudinal slot 39 in the shuttle 37 is thus disengaged from a cross slot 58 in a stationary block 57 while at the same time one of the half-nuts 24 is engaged with one of the power screws 25 or 26. The power shift of the barrel 21 then takes place and the pinion 20 slides into mesh when it can, while the tongue 38 drops back into another locking cross slot 58 with the manual lever 48 returned. to its original position by springs 47. During the speed change, a main clutch between the driven shaft 19 and a tail shaft (not shown) is momentarily opened. This clutch is shown schematically at 55. Displacement of the lever 48 rocks geared twin shafts 53 in opposite directions and these by rocking four cams 54 thrust the disc 55 right to open the clutch.
